EagleDriver95 Posted October 7, 2020 Share Posted October 7, 2020 Using several different weapons I have encountered an issue where the TPOD cue in the HUD is several miles off the designated point that the TPOD is actually pointing at. The videos I've provided are from a mission in the Persian Gulf map where I was using a JTAC to laser-designate for a GBU-12; the pod acquired his laser but the HUD cue and bomb fall line cue diverged by several miles. In the second video clip from the same mission I tried just using the pod to designate (TDC depress and point track on the vehicle target), but the HUD cue and fall line cue still are off of each other significantly, making it impossible to drop the bomb. If having used WPDSG to slew the pod near the target area coordinates is the problem in this instance - I can understand, but I was under the impression that LST lock and TDC depress updated the target location in the computer. https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=Fv804oLKtEo https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=Fv804oLKtEo I had another instance however that did not involve waypoints which makes me think this is a recurring issue. I unfortunately don't have a track/video but it re-occurred in several mission attempts and I can describe. In one of the last missions of BalticDragon's Raven One campaign, you have to target a submarine on the surface to hit with a laser maverick. Pointing the pod at the sub, acquiring an IR point track, and pressing TDC depress, the HUD cue was still several miles off to the right -- and even though the laser seeker in the maverick would slew to the sub's physical location, it wouldn't lock or allow a launch. I do have a track file but it is 15 MB and exceeds the size limit of 5MB here. Have flown the Hornet for quite some time without issues with the TPOD and was just curious if this is an issue that may have cropped up in recent updates. Several members of my virtual squadron also mentioned they have had TPOD alignment issues in recent weeks. squid509 Posted October 7, 2020 Share Posted October 7, 2020 https://forums.eagle.ru/showthread.php?t=283532 from looking at your vid it seams you are having INS drift problems and you INS switch is not in IFA try placing your INS switch in IFA after the INS system is aligned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
